Despite being a remake of the 1960s BBC series, this comes across as an uninspired cross between Contact and Species. It is filmed using the typical cheap BBC Sci-Fi manner i.e. dull, grey, overcast and in a quarry. They spend the budget on the one "special effect", which is, of course, destroyed at the end. The story is unconvincing and the basic science is badly flawed (real time communication to Andromeda anyone?)

It tries to pad out a thin story line with the addition of a few extraneous few subplots, namely a love triangle, some espionage and the oh so stereotypical "government subverting science for evil" thing. Even Jane Asher can't drag this up from being a long, slow, and predictable hour and a half.
